From the catalog I looked for new ones.

NEW & NOT RELEASED
  • ENDURA 4 TITANIUM DAMASCUS
  • MATRIARCH 2 WITH EMERSON OPENER BLACK BLADE
  • STRETCH 2 G-10 ZDP-189
  • SALT 1 LIGHTWEIGHT BLACK BLADE
  • PACIFIC SALT LIGHTWEIGHT BLACK BLADE
  • ASSIST SALT
  • CHAPARRAL BLUE STEPPED TITANIUM
  • FOUNDRY
  • ROADIE
  • DOG TAG FOLDER BLACK
  • PITS FOLDER
  • URBAN LIGHTWEIGHT
  • SZABOHAWK
  • JANISONG
  • SCHEMPP BOWIE
  • BRADLEY BOWIE
  • REVERSE
  • RONIN 2
  • AQUA SALT BLACK BLADE
NEW & ALREADY RELEASED
  • NATIVE 5 LIGHTWEIGHT BLACK
  • MANIX 2 LIGHTWEIGHT CPM S110V
  • LIL’ LIONSPY
  • K2
  • SLYSZ BOWIE
  • BURCH CHUBBY
  • DOG TAG FOLDER
  • DICE
  • RUBICON
SPRINTS
  • Perrin PPT Black Blade
  • Squeak SLIPIT
  • Dragonfly 2 Lightweight
  • Pingo “ClipJoint”
NOT MARKED AS NEW & NOT RELEASED
  • MIKE DRAPER FOLDER
  • FIREFLY
  • ROC
